Tower solar thermal power generation is divided into
According to the concentrating method, solar thermal power generation can be divided into point focusing and line focusing. The point focusing is relatively high, including the tower type and the dish type; the line focusing ratio is relatively low, including the trough type and. . All solar thermal power systems have solar energy collectors with two main components: reflectors (mirrors) that capture and focus sunlight onto a receiver. In most types of systems, a heat-transfer fluid is heated and circulated in the receiver and used to produce steam. A heat-transfer fluid heated in the receiver is used to heat a working fluid, which, in turn, is used in a conventional. . Concentrating solar power (CSP) is naturally incorporated with thermal energy storage, providing readily dispatchable electricity and the potential to contribute significantly to grid penetration of high-percentage renewable energy sources. This fluid then transfers its heat to water, which then becomes superheated steam.
